Autonomous Trucks Are No Longer Sci-Fi
Autonomous trucks are now rolling confidently on highways across the globe. In 2025, self-driving technology in truckload transportation is redefining long-haul logistics. These driverless vehicles are equipped with advanced sensors, LIDAR, radar systems, and AI software that allow them to operate with minimal human intervention. Companies are cutting costs, reducing accidents, and operating 24/7 with this innovation. While regulatory frameworks are still evolving, autonomous trucks are proving their worth in controlled environments and pilot programs. The shift to automation is reducing driver fatigue and filling driver shortages, making it a practical solution for modern supply chains.
